More DescriptionThe sweeping epic of Banner Saga is far from over. Not when every character is a thread of a greater tapestry, one far too large for anyone to raise alone. Cue Stoic's amazing fanbase.Together at last are ten tales set in the Banner Saga universe, a combination of classic short stories as well as those selected from our very fans. From the First Great War to the exodus of Tistel, the founding of Nautmot to Rugga's rise of power. This anthology cherry-picks the best of several emerging author, including Alex Singer and Black Library author Evan Dicken. Tales from the Caravan is a tour de force¿ and a herald of more to come. Also includes "Stranded" by Alex Thomas and James Fadeley, once available only as an audiobook.
